About Wahroonga
Wahroonga sits at the prestigious heart of the upper North Shore, an elevated suburb where nearly 18,000 residents enjoy grand homes and bushland surrounds. The train station provides Northern Line connectivity, though many residents prefer private school drop-offs in their prestige vehicles. This is old money North Shore—quiet, leafy, and decidedly refined.
The small village shopping strip maintains traditional character, while nearby Hornsby provides major retail. The private hospitals and elite schools draw families from across Sydney, and the bushland setting includes significant natural reserves. Wahroonga attracts established wealth, medical professionals, and families committed to private education. It's North Shore living at its most traditionally prestigious.
Wahroonga falls under postcode 2076 and is governed by Hornsby Council (LGA). For state elections, residents vote in the Wahroonga electorate.
